Wash, clean and cut meat with bines. Grind together the
onions, green chillies, coriander leaves, ginger, coconut and garlic. Heat fat,
add ground masala and fry for a few minutes. Add meat, salt and enough water to
cook till meat is tender. Add garam masala and mix well.
Pulao
Boil water with garam masala and salt. Add washed and
drained rice and simmer for 5 minutes. Drain. In a strong pan melt half the fat.
Put in rice and meat in layers. Pour remaining melted fat on top, when the
layers are completed. Seal and keep in the oven for 10 -15 minutes.
